## Idempotency Keys for Payment Retries (Lumopay)

Every retry of a charge request must reuse the original idempotency key; generating a new key on retry can produce duplicate charges. Keys are scoped per merchant and expire after 48 hours. Reviewers should verify keys are derived server-side, never from client input. The full key-generation specification and threat model are maintained on the internal page.

dashboard of kaguf-tawip = https://vault.merlaqsys.test/issue

### Runbook: BounceBroom — Account Recovery

If the BounceBroom email bounce processor loses access to its service account, do not create a new one. First, pause the intake queue so bounces buffer safely. Then open the recovery console and select the BounceBroom principal. Verification requires approval from the on-call lead. Once approved, the console prompts for the stored recovery credentials; enter the passphrase that appears directly below this paragraph.

recovery phrase for fahof-kahap: holion-gormir-jorix-istix-briwyn-sorael

Quick note for the release manager: the Stallbrook occupancy feed job failed overnight again. The parser chokes when the garage controller reports negative free-space counts (yes, that happens when sensors double-count exits). We've patched the ingest step to clamp values at zero and log the anomaly instead of crashing the pipeline. Nightly builds should be green again, but please spot-check the Westgate garage numbers before promoting. The token for the fixed build goes right below.

session token of fahap-hawip = htk31_7852f2b3276dba2738f98fa97f92237

TURN-208: Gatevale turnstile counters at the Merrow Field pilot double-count when a rotation reverses mid-cycle. Attendance totals drift roughly 2% high per event. The debounce window fix is implemented, reviewed by Ilsa, and soak-tested across two simulated match days without drift. Ready for your cut; the candidate build is identified below.

trace token, tagag-tafog: htk6_5ed18c